Brian Douglas: Internațional Children’s Day 1st June 2020

The origin of Internațional children’s day dates back to 1925 at a high level meeting of several countries în Geneva and has been a national children’s holiday ever since. The actual date of 1st June is used by many former Eastern block countries aș the internațional day of child protection from when this date was established în 1950.
